Recently, Michael emailed me a picture of a similar table (his version included backrests) and asked if I had plans. That was the nudge I needed to model it in SketchUp.
This version doesn’t have backrests, but you could easily tweak the design to add them. The spacing between the tabletop and seats should make it easy to slide in or out, but you can adjust the length of the base frame rails if you want more or less room.
